PHILADELPHIA — The Eagles showcased their formidable skills with a commanding win Sunday against Washington, highlighted by standout performances from key players. The game reflected both individual brilliance and cohesive team effort, solidifying Philadelphia’s position in the league.
Defensive back Cooper DeJean made a significant impact with a critical interception in the third quarter, shifting momentum firmly in favor of the Eagles. His persistence as a tackler contributed to the defensive strategy, as he recorded four defended passes throughout the contest. DeJean is quickly establishing himself as an essential figure in the Eagles’ secondary.
Quarterback Jalen Hurts continued to demonstrate his prowess under center, completing 22 of his 30 pass attempts for 185 yards and two touchdowns. His efficiency and calm demeanor facilitated early connections with wide receiver A.J. Brown, who tallied nine receptions for 95 yards. Hurts complemented his passing attack with an additional 40 yards on the ground, showcasing his versatility and ability to move the ball effectively.
Running back Saquon Barkley made headlines with a dazzling 48-yard run that exemplified his elusiveness. After spinning out of a tackle behind the line of scrimmage, Barkley bolted down the left sideline, breaking yet another tackle before being brought down. His impressive 12-yard touchdown run later in the game provided a crucial two-possession lead for the Eagles, which they maintained until the final whistle. Barkley finished with a remarkable 132 rushing yards on 21 carries, scoring two touchdowns that underscored his importance to the team’s offense.
